What is the typical cost of preschool in Saint Anne, Illinois, and are there any local assistance programs?

In Saint Anne and the surrounding Kankakee County area, preschool costs can range from approximately $150 to $250 per week, depending on the program's schedule and structure. For financial assistance, families should inquire about the Kankakee County Preschool For All program, which provides state-funded preschool to eligible 3- and 4-year-olds, and check if the local school district offers tuition-based or grant-supported early childhood classrooms.

How do I verify the quality and licensing of a preschool in Saint Anne?

All licensed preschools in Illinois must meet standards set by the Department of Children and Family Services (DCFS). You can verify a specific program's license status and view any history of violations through the DCFS website. Additionally, asking if the program is accredited by the National Association for the Education of Young Children (NAEYC) or participates in Illinois' ExceleRate quality rating system provides further insight into quality.

What are the main types of preschool programs available in Saint Anne?

Options in Saint Anne typically include faith-based preschools often affiliated with local churches, private daycare centers with preschool curricula, and the state-funded Preschool For All program which may be housed within the local school district. Given the rural setting, some families also consider home-based licensed daycare programs that offer preschool learning activities.

When should I start the enrollment process for a preschool in Saint Anne?

Due to limited options in a smaller community, it is advisable to begin researching and contacting preschools at least 6-9 months before your desired start date, often in the fall or winter prior. Many programs, especially the district-affiliated Preschool For All, have specific application periods in early spring for the following academic year, so timing is crucial.

What should I look for regarding safety and transportation for preschools in this area?

Ensure the facility has secure entry procedures and a clear emergency plan. Given Saint Anne's location, inquire about policies for severe weather common to Illinois. For transportation, most private preschools do not provide bus service, so parents should plan for drop-off and pick-up. The local school district may provide transportation for its own district-run preschool programs.
